Ex-Arsenal Defender Sokratis Has Been Offered to Lazio, Considerations Underway

Former Arsenal defender Sokratis Papastathopoulos’ agents have offered the player to Lazio, according to a report from Italian journalist Enrico De Lellis on his Twitter page yesterday.

The 32-year-old Greek defender agreed to mutually terminate his contract with the Gunners yesterday, after two and a half years in North London, making him available to sign for a new club on a free transfer.

He has many suitors, including Genoa in Italy, who have offered him a three-year contract worth €1.8 million net per season.

Lazio are considering Sokratis, but the issue is that by signing him they would be forced to exclude a player from the Serie A squad registration list, and that player is likely to be Luiz Felipe.

The 23-year-old Brazilian defender is set to undergo ankle surgery today or tomorrow, and isn’t expected to recover until early April.

The Biancocelesti are reflecting upon the offer and if it is worth cutting Luiz Felipe from the Serie A squad registration list.
